The current static-https-redirect.vhost config doesn't allow publishing a .htaccess file in order to setup redirects. We do use redirects on sites that share data over both http and https. This change enables the same options for static https sites. The motivation is to allow release.o.o to use .htacces to provide static, human friendly URLs for constraints that persist after branch deletion in the openstack/requirements Repo. See: http://lists.openstack.org/pipermail/openstack-discuss/2019-February/002682.html Note: in that discussion I tested with RewriteRule but Redirect work and that is what I'm proposing. README.md
Puppet Modules
These are a set of puppet manifests and modules that are currently being used to manage the OpenStack Project infrastructure.
The main entry point is in manifests/site.pp.
In general, most of the modules here are designed to be able to be run either in agent or apply mode.
These puppet modules require puppet 2.7 or greater. Additionally, the site.pp manifest assumes the existence of hiera.
See http://docs.openstack.org/infra/system-config for more information.
Documentation
The documentation presented at http://docs.openstack.org/infra/system-config comes from git://git.openstack.org/openstack-infra/system-config repo's docs/source. To build the documentation use
$ tox -evenv python setup.py build_sphinx
